The invention discloses a semi-active suspension control system. The system comprises a main control module, and a signal output module, a signal detection module, a CAN module and a driving module which are electrically connected with the main control module, the signal output module is used for outputting an inductance response signal according to the inductance signal and the trigger inductance signal; the signal detection module is used for detecting acceleration signals of all axes on the semi-active suspension; the CAN module is used for reading vehicle motion parameters; the main control module is used for determining height signals of all shafts on the semi-active suspension according to the time of the inductance response signals and outputting current driving instructions according to the height signals, the acceleration signals and the vehicle motion parameters; and the driving module is used for controlling the opening degree of an electromagnetic valve in the shock absorber according to the current driving instruction. According to the scheme, the damping parameters are adjusted by sensing the semi-active suspension parameters and the vehicle body motion parameters, and therefore the vehicle running smoothness and stability are improved.
